Detox and rehabilitation are not the very same thing
Detox is the medically managed process of removing alcohol from your system while taking care of withdrawal signs and symptoms. It is brief, generally 3 to 7 days. The major objective is security. The secondary goal is comfort.
Rehab is what comes next. It consists of therapy, education and learning, drug for relapse avoidance, family members job, and method living without alcohol. Rehabilitation can be domestic, partial a hospital stay, or outpatient. It usually recently to months. Consider detox as a runway and rehab as the trip. You require both to get to a destination.
In Tinton Falls, many individuals full detox at a committed device, a hospital‑based program, or an accredited withdrawal management facility, then enter alcohol rehab Tinton Falls or a neighboring outpatient program. Some centers pack both under one roof covering; others coordinate with companion programs around Monmouth County.

Day one and the first 72 hours
The intake registered nurse will inspect important indicators, blood alcohol material if appropriate, and area you on a standardized analysis like CIWA‑Ar, a verified tool that scores withdrawal symptoms. You will typically receive thiamine, folate, and a multivitamin early to safeguard the mind and protect against Wernicke's encephalopathy, which is uncommon however severe. If you are already unsteady, sweaty, anxious, or nauseated, the doctor or registered nurse specialist starts symptom‑driven medication promptly.
Here is exactly how the first stretch often unfolds.
- Hour 0 to 12: Intake, labs, hydration, vitamins, and a very first dosage of medicine if suggested. You may really feel groggy or agitated. Personnel check on you often.
- Hour 12 to 24: Signs and symptoms can increase. Shake, anxiousness, inadequate sleep, and blood pressure spikes prevail. Medication dosages are adapted to your score and vitals. Basic food, fluids, and short strolls help.
- Day 2: If withdrawal threats are higher, this is a vital day. Seizure risk is higher in the initial 48 hours. The group enjoys carefully. Several patients begin to maintain, with much less trembling and better sleep.
- Day 3: Signs and symptoms often alleviate. The group shifts towards preparation. You satisfy a therapist, go over triggers, and map the next degree of care. If readily available, you may participate in a brief group or a one‑on‑one session.
- Day 4 to 7: Length relies on extent, co‑occurring problems, and feedback to medications. Some discharge on day 3, others need a couple of more days to land gently.
Families in some cases fear that medicines simply change one material with one more. Done effectively, detoxification relies on short programs of medicines that lessen as signs fix. The strategy is individualized and time‑limited.
Medications used in alcohol detox
Most units utilize symptom‑triggered benzodiazepines, since this course lowers the threat of seizures and delirium tremens when alcohol quits. Usual choices include diazepam and lorazepam. Dosages are not one size fits all. Older grownups, individuals with liver disease, or those with extreme sleep apnea need mindful adjustments.
Adjuncts reduce certain signs. Gabapentin can minimize anxiousness and sleeplessness. Clonidine or propranolol assists with free signs like fast heart rate and tremor. Hydroxyzine or trazodone supports sleep. Antipsychotics such as haloperidol may be used briefly for severe frustration or hallucinations, however not as a standalone for seizure prevention. Thiamine is non‑negotiable, given before glucose when feasible. Extra extreme or difficult situations often call for inpatient medical facility administration with IV fluids, electrolyte modification, and continual monitoring.
A good detox program go for the lowest reliable medicine dosage and quits it as soon as it is safe. The goal is not a chemical padding for weeks. It is risk-free passage.
Understanding risk: who requires inpatient detox
Not everyone requires inpatient detox. Light to modest withdrawal can be taken care of at home with everyday facility check‑ins and prescriptions, especially when there is strong social assistance and no significant health conditions. That claimed, particular aspects press the scale towards managed treatment:
- History of withdrawal seizures or ecstasy tremens, even once.
- Heavy or long period of time of alcohol consumption, for example a pint or even more of alcohol daily for months.
- Significant medical issues such as heart problem, uncontrolled diabetes, or liver failure.
- Pregnant individuals, who require collaborated obstetric and addiction care.
- Lack of a trusted sober caregiver at home.

What rehabilitation appears like after detox
The handoff from detoxification to rehab forms the following six months. Solid programs build that bridge early. You will likely meet an instance manager or counselor by day two that schedules the very first appointments, arranges transportation when needed, and checks insurance policy coverage. Options include:
- Residential rehab, generally 2 to 4 weeks, for those who require an organized setting without very easy accessibility to alcohol.
- Partial hospitalization, 5 days each week for numerous hours daily, with nights at home.
- Intensive outpatient, 3 to 4 days weekly, usually at nights to balance job or family.
- Standard outpatient treatment, once or twice weekly, commonly paired with peer support.
Therapies differ, however cognitive behavior modification and motivational speaking with are mainstays. Several programs in this region add trauma‑informed treatment, household sessions, and skills training for rest, stress and anxiety, and interaction. A reliable alcohol rehab Tinton Falls strategy looks ordinary on paper however requiring in life: consistent therapy, peer connection, medicine when appropriate, and day‑to‑day issue addressing at home and work.
Medication for relapse prevention
Detox addresses withdrawal, not craving or regression threat. Continuous alcohol addiction treatment typically includes drug:
- Naltrexone reduces benefit from drinking and can reduce hefty drinking days. It comes as an everyday pill or a month-to-month injection. It is an excellent suitable for numerous, unless there is acute hepatitis or opioid use.
- Acamprosate sustains abstaining by alleviating post‑acute signs like interior uneasyness. It is dosed 3 times everyday and works best as soon as you are alcohol‑free.
- Disulfiram produces an aversive reaction if you consume on it. It benefits individuals that want a strong external brake and have reputable supervision.
- Off label medications such as topiramate or gabapentin can help some people that do not tolerate first‑line options.
The option depends upon goals. Somebody aiming for total abstaining could select acamprosate or naltrexone. Somebody attempting to decrease heavy drinking days, en path to abstaining, might start with naltrexone. A patient with severe liver illness needs additional care and frequently favors acamprosate.

Special populations and professional judgment
One size never ever fits all. Right here are situations where strategies commonly shift:
- Older grownups metabolize medicines in a different way, and drop risk is actual. Lower benzodiazepine doses, slower tapers, and added interest to hydration and electrolytes protect against complications.
- People with liver illness require mindful medication selection. Lorazepam is usually chosen in serious liver disability because it stays clear of energetic metabolites. Naltrexone could be postponed till liver function improves.
- Pregnant people need coordinated treatment. The concern is mother's stablizing, fetal surveillance when indicated, and mindful medicine selections. Early prenatal control makes a difference.
- Those with co‑occurring psychological health and wellness problems benefit from incorporated care. Deal with neglected clinical depression, PTSD, or ADHD alongside alcohol use disorder. Prevent chasing after one issue at a time.
- People with chronic pain need reasonable strategies. A great program brings discomfort management into the discussion early, with non‑opioid approaches, physical therapy references, and worked with prescribing.
The usual string is customization. The right strategy is the one you can adhere to securely, not the one that looks perfect on paper.

Therapy that sticks after detox
People do not regression for absence of information. They regression when tension spikes, rest collapses, or they run into an old pattern without a strategy. Efficient treatment targets those genuine moments. If alcohol rehab consists of just lectures, you will certainly learn intriguing facts and little else. Programs that mix individual treatment, skills practice, and peer discussion educate you to take care of the edge cases: the coworker who stress you consistently, the anniversary of a loss, the evening you do not sleep up until 3 a.m.
Look for a plan that practices feedbacks. Technique saying no with a full sentence. Method leaving a party in the first 15 minutes without explanation. Technique purchasing soda water with lime without a long story. It feels uncomfortable in the beginning. It gets simpler quickly.
Medication plus therapy is not a prop. It is a wise pairing. People who use both have a tendency to stay engaged longer.

What progression actually looks like
New people sometimes expect a rise of power once the alcohol leaves. What they feel is extra subtle. The initial actual win is typically a consistent hand. Then a complete evening of sleep turns up, usually in between days 3 and 7. Morning nausea or vomiting fades. Blood pressure normalizes. The mind gets rid of enough to identify patterns.
Cravings can be found in waves. The first tidy quiet Saturday can feel empty and risky. An excellent strategy loads it with easy framework: a conference, a walk, food preparation something you actually intend to eat, a telephone call with a person safe. Over weeks, power returns. Over months, self-confidence expands. The brain's reward system, down‑regulated by years of alcohol, recalibrates. It does not break back in a week. It changes with repetition.
Common misunderstandings that enter the way
Two ideas cause a lot of harm. The very first is waiting on ideal readiness. Readiness is not a door that opens up completely. It is a home window that splits. If the home window is open today, action. Programs in Tinton Falls can usually begin the procedure swiftly when you call.
The secondly is the myth that a person slip eliminates progress. A slip is information. It informs you where the strategy was thin. Utilize it to strengthen the plan, not to validate a tale that you can not change. People that mount slides as details come back on track faster.
